4 gigs is for multiple screens however I have no idea about the performance limits of the GTX 680 but if it is speedy then the 4 gigs of video ram will help with multiple monitor setups.
same story with the gtx 770 - they're full multi monitor set-ups. If you've got just 1 1080p monitor then you can save money by getting the 2GB version or getting a weaker card.
